What is Millicoulomb to Coulomb Conversion?
Millicoulomb (mC) and coulomb (C) are both units used to measure electric-charge, but they serve different purposes depending on the scale of the measurement. If you ever need to convert millicoulomb to coulomb, knowing the exact conversion formula is essential.
MC to c Conversion Formula:
One Millicoulomb is equal to 0.001 Coulomb.
Formula: 1 mC = 0.001 C
By using this conversion factor, you can easily convert any electric-charge from millicoulomb to coulomb with precision.
How to Convert mC to C?
Converting from mC to C is a straightforward process. Follow these steps to ensure accurate conversions from millicoulomb to coulomb:
- Select the Millicoulomb Value: Start by determining the millicoulomb (mC) value you want to convert into coulomb (C). This is your starting point.
- Multiply by the Conversion Factor: To convert millicoulomb to coulomb, multiply the selected mC value by 0.001. This factor is essential for accurately converting from a smaller unit (mC) to a much larger unit (C).
- Illustration of Multiplication:
- 1 mC = 0.001 C
- 10 mC = 0.01 C
- 100 mC = 0.1 C
- Find the Conversion Result: The result of this multiplication is your converted value in coulomb unit. This represents the same electric-charge but in a different unit.
- Save Your Coulomb Value: After converting, remember to save the result. This value represents the electric-charge you initially measured, now expressed in coulombs.
- Alternative Method – Division: If you prefer not to multiply, you can achieve the same conversion by dividing the millicoulomb value by 1000. This alternative method also gives you the correct electric-charge in coulombs.
- Illustration of Division:
- C = mc ÷ 1000
What is Electric Charge?
An electric charge is a fundamental physical property of matter that causes it to experience a force when placed in an electromagnetic field.
